**Key Ceremony Checklist — Item 7: Verify rounding reconciliation before sealing**

Before the Ledgewick conversion keys are sealed, confirm the rounding ledger balances to zero across all currency pairs. Run the reconciliation job twice; discrepancies above half a minor unit block the ceremony. Known cause: the Florin-pair table truncates instead of rounding half-even — check it first. Record the final reconciliation hash in the ceremony log with two witnesses present. Once verified, seal the key shards using the recovery passphrase below.

vault phrase of taweg-kafof = oliax-zorael

Subject: Quickstore 4.2 — bloom filter now fronts the KV layer

Plugin authors: starting with this release, Quickstore places a bloom filter ahead of the key-value store. Negative lookups return faster; false positives fall through safely. No API changes are required on your side. Verify your plugin against the staging build referenced below.

session token of fahif-tadup = htk3_9c7

Finance Review Summary — Reseller Programme (Q3)

Heads of department: the Ostrel Partner Programme delivered 18% of gross revenue, below the 25% target. Margin leakage from tier-two resellers in the Caldmere region remains the main drag. Verrow Analytics renewed; Dunhale Trading churned. Rebate accruals are overstated by roughly 6% and will be corrected next cycle. Programme restructure options were reviewed with the commercial lead, Petra Onsel. The confidential plan for next quarter is set out below.

internal memo for hafog-hadug: The pricing group signed off on a budget of $16.1 million for Project Gorir. The renewal with Oliionax Systems closes at $14.1 million a year, 46 percent above the last contract.

**Ticket PX-2291: Payroll export format change — needs sign-off.** Heads up, new folks: we're switching the Saltgrove payroll export from fixed-width to delimited, because the old format kept truncating long surnames. The change touches the nightly batch and the archive job, so both need a dry run against last month's data before we flip the flag. Nothing ships until we get written approval from the person responsible.

account owner for bawip-tahag: Raleth Quenok